Linked Intelligent Master Model (LIMM)LIMM IntroductionLIMM is a set of processes and technologies that link key product parameters to engineering models. This provides the capabilities for engineers to quickly evaluate design alternatives by changing the value of parameters and understand the impact of the change in the context of multiple analysis and design models. LIMM Consulting Practice OverviewThe LIMM practice is a methodology to identify and map key product parameters to specific engineering models. This information is used to package existing models for reuse in design studies. LIMM Technology OverviewThe LIMM technologies enable rapid web based deployment of capabilities to modify parameters, update models, execute simulations, review simulation results and evaluate the results based on engineering rules and design targets. LIMM Customer Success Example"We have a relatively small R&D team with the analysis skills necessary to support product development. Our R&D team supports all product lines and allocating resources across many product lines has always been a challenge. Historically if a product manager needed to run an analysis or re-run an analysis, the project would wait in queue while our experts were performing analysis on other product lines. This caused our product managers to make a decision about progressing without the analysis and risk problems in production or delay product development due to the unavailability of our analysis experts. Since LIMM was implemented, our standard operating procedure is to run each analysis that is affected by a change before proceeding. We are able to do this and still reduce overall time to market (concept to first customer ship) by more than 15%. In addition, our experts are no longer required for day-to-day analysis task; they now spend their time developing analysis techniques for problems we have not yet been able to address with simulation."
